SignatureDoesNotMatch through a proxy¶
SigV4 signs the Host header. A proxy that rewrites it invalidates every signature.
Caddy and Traefik preserve Host by default; Nginx does not unless told to.
Confirm the diagnosis by bypassing the proxy:
AWS_ACCESS_KEY_ID=<your-access-key> \
AWS_SECRET_ACCESS_KEY=<your-secret-key> \
aws --endpoint-url http://127.0.0.1:7600 s3 ls

CORS¶
A browser blocks the request before you ever see it in Record Store's logs.
aws --endpoint-url https://storage.example.com \
s3api put-bucket-cors --bucket uploads \
--cors-configuration file://cors.json
{
"CORSRules": [
{
"AllowedOrigins": ["https://app.example.com"],
"AllowedMethods": ["GET", "PUT", "POST", "HEAD"],
"AllowedHeaders": ["*"],
"ExposeHeaders": ["ETag"],
"MaxAgeSeconds": 3000
}
]
}
Points that catch people out:
- Origins are exact.
https://app.example.comdoes not matchhttps://www.app.example.com, and scheme and port are part of the origin. ExposeHeaders: ["ETag"]is required for browser-side multipart uploads.- Preflight is
OPTIONS. A proxy that drops or interceptsOPTIONSbreaks CORS regardless of the bucket configuration.
Check the preflight directly:
curl -i -X OPTIONS https://storage.example.com/uploads/test.txt \
-H "Origin: https://app.example.com" \
-H "Access-Control-Request-Method: PUT"
Share and embed links point at 127.0.0.1¶
Record Store cannot infer its public hostname from behind a proxy.
RECORD_STORE_SHARING_SHARE_BASE_URL=https://console.example.com
RECORD_STORE_SHARING_EMBED_BASE_URL=https://storage.example.com
Two different hosts: a share link is a page on the console, an embed serves bytes from the storage endpoint.
Both must be absolute http:// or https:// URLs, no whitespace, under 512 bytes.
Rate limits apply to everyone at once¶
Share password attempts and unknown-token probes are limited per client, and the client
is identified from the first entry of X-Forwarded-For. Without that header, every
visitor behind the proxy shares one counter.
Have the proxy overwrite rather than append any header the client sent — the value is attacker-influenced.
Console cannot reach the management API¶
The console's server calls it; the browser never does.
Use the internal service or host name, not localhost — in a container, localhost is
the console's own container.

TLS certificate errors from clients¶
- Is the full chain served? Many clients are stricter than browsers about intermediates.
- Does the certificate name match the endpoint the client uses?
- Is the certificate current?
A reverse proxy configuration that works¶
server {
listen 443 ssl;
http2 on;
server_name storage.example.com;
ssl_certificate /etc/letsencrypt/live/storage.example.com/fullchain.pem;
ssl_certificate_key /etc/letsencrypt/live/storage.example.com/privkey.pem;
client_max_body_size 0;
proxy_request_buffering off;
location / {
proxy_pass http://127.0.0.1:7600;
proxy_http_version 1.1;
proxy_set_header Host $host;
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_set_header X-Forwarded-Proto $scheme;
proxy_read_timeout 600s;
proxy_send_timeout 600s;
}
}
